Job Summary:

Are you passionate about electronics and skilled at troubleshooting and repairing electronic devices? We are seeking a talented Electronic Repair Technician to join our team. As an Electronic Repair Technician, you will be responsible for diagnosing and repairing a variety of electronic equipment, ranging from consumer electronics to industrial machinery. This is an exciting opportunity to work with both older and newer technologies, ensuring the functionality and reliability of electronic devices for personal, public, and company use.

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Diagnose hardware and software issues in electronic devices, including but not limited to video game consoles, clocks, radios, toys, televisions, and other electronic equipment.
  • Disassemble and reassemble electronic devices to identify and replace defective components.
  • Use diagnostic tools and equipment such as oscilloscopes, voltmeters, and other electronic testing gear to test and repair electronic circuits and systems.
  • Follow standard repair procedures and guidelines to ensure quality and efficiency.
  • Keep accurate records of repairs performed and parts used.
  • Communicate effectively with customers to provide updates on repair status and recommendations for device maintenance.
  • Collaborate with team members to troubleshoot complex technical issues and find solutions.
  • Source repair parts and manage inventory for repair projects.
  • Maintain a detailed understanding of how electronics work and stay updated on new technologies and repair techniques.
